prices on 5 modelsMini-Jack (3.5 mm)
— this connector is very popular in modern electronics: in portable devices it is the main option for connecting headphones, and most of the headphones themselves (of all price categories) have a “native” plug for the mini-Jack. However, due to a number of technical features in Hi-Fi and Hi-End equipment, including audio receivers, this interface is not widely used.| mini-Jack (3.5 mm) | clear | Save List |
